Analysis

In 2023, synthetic fertilizers — direct emissions in Cabo Verde stood at 0.0021 kt.

The figure is up 16.7% on the previous year and up 50.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, synthetic fertilizers — direct emissions in Cabo Verde peaked at 0.0038 kt in 2001 and was at its lowest, 0 kt, in 1961.

That places Cabo Verde 32nd out of 32 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
